Alright, let's talk about the Annis 300R in Grand Theft Auto V. This car was part of the Los Santos Drug Wars DLC, which dropped on December 13th, 2022. It's basically a virtual Nissan Z, and it was a bit of a special case because it was only available for a limited time, until December 29th. Rockstar sometimes does this to create a bit of urgency, you know? It might come back later, but if you wanted it, you had to act fast.
Now, for the big question: how much is this thing going to set you back? The base price for the Annis 300R is a hefty $2,075,000. And that's before you even start thinking about upgrades, which, as you'll see, aren't exactly cheap either. Annis 300R Cosmetic Upgrades
You can really customize the look of the Annis 300R. Here's a breakdown of the cosmetic upgrades and their prices:
| Upgrade | Price |
| Fenders 1-6 | $11,520 - $14,760 |
| Front Bumpers 1-13 | $4,600 - $16,100 |
| Engine Covers 1-14 | $45,120 - $67,680 |
| Exhaust 1-8 | $750 - $13,750 |
| Hoods 1-18 | $3,000 - $14,650 |
| Xenon Lights | $7,500 |
| Livery Designs 1-9 | $18,240 - $25,650 |
| Mirrors 1-6 | $900 - $3,300 |
| Rear Panels 1-3 | $4,600 - $11,700 |
| Roof 1-12 | $700 - $5,050 |
| Skirts 1-9 | $5,500 - $16,500 |
| Spoiler 1-16 | $7,050 - $21,000 |
| Suspension 1-5 | $1,000 - $4,600 |
Annis 300R Performance Upgrades
When it comes to performance, you've got these options:
| Upgrade | Price |
| Armour Upgrade 1-5 | $3,750 - $25,000 |
| Brakes 1-3 | $20,000 - $35,000 |
| Engine Tunes 1-4 | $9,000 - $33,500 |
| Transmission 1-3 | $29,500 - $40,000 |
| Turbo | $50,000 |
Is The Annis 300R Worth Buying?
Honestly, it's not a cheap car, and that limited-time availability really pushes you to make a decision quickly. If we're talking pure performance, the Annis 300R isn't going to blow you away. Its top speed puts it somewhere around 40th place in the Sports Car class. So, the main draw here is really its potential scarcity because it was initially only available for a short period. If that changes and it becomes readily available, then there are definitely better ways to spend your hard-earned cash in GTA Online.
